  • the present invention relates to a location-related triggering of a locally triggerable and electronically controlled action. More particularly, the present invention relates to a method and system for location-based triggering of a location-triggered and electronically-controlled action.
  • Locally triggered and electronically controlled actions are triggered or driven and / or executed by executing a corresponding code.
  • the locally triggered and electronically controlled actions can be triggered or controlled at specific locations. Such actions are e.g. in the simplest case, opening a garage door or a barrier, releasing a ticket, starting or stopping a machine, etc.
  • the locally triggered and electronically controlled actions actively require an action by the participant through conventional interaction mechanisms (eg via display and / or through Keystroke) at the scene. However, the participant's attention to perform this interaction is not fully available by the situation, e.g.
  • the party concerned is not allowed to be distracted to fulfill a current task or activity or if he / she does not independently trigger the electronically triggered interaction (eg pressing a button or looking at a display) due to special restrictions (eg gloves, suit or other disability) or only under difficult circumstances.
  • electronically triggered interaction eg pressing a button or looking at a display
  • special restrictions eg gloves, suit or other disability
  • NFC Near Field Communication
  • NFC NFC still requires the attention of the participant. He must know the location of the NFC site and bring his NFC reader or NFC label (depending on which of the deployed units is the reader) to the system.

  • FIG. 1 shows a system for the location-related triggering of a locally triggerable and electronically controlled action according to an embodiment of the present invention.
  • FIG. 1 shows a system 1 for the location-related triggering of a locally triggered and electronically controlled action 15 according to an exemplary embodiment of the present invention.
  • the system 1 comprises, according to the present embodiment, an information server 12 as an information managing device.
  • the information server 12 is configured to manage action-related data and coordinates to the action-related data. It should be noted that the information server 12 may also manage other data and information (e.g., texts, pictures, videos, music data, etc.).
  • the information server 12 has at least one memory module 122 in which the action-related data are stored linked to the respective coordinates to the action-related data.
  • the corresponding links of the action-related data and the respective coordinates are shown in FIG. 1 as blocks 122_1,..., 122_n. It should be noted that not only a block-like but a diverse storage of data (action-related data, text, images, etc.) and their links to the respective coordinates is possible.
  • a mobile device 11 such as a mobile phone, PDA (Personal Digital Assistant), laptop etc. in the system 1 is configured to cyclically or at intervals its current position or its current geographical coordinates (eg determined by GPS (Global Positioning system)) to the information server 12 to transmit or send.
  • the transmission or transmission of position data is shown in Fig. 1 by the arrow Sl.
  • the information server 12 has a detecting module 121 that receives the position data or coordinates sent from the mobile device 11, and that evaluates the position data or coordinates. In doing so, S3 determines the determining module 121 of the information server 12 whether there are corresponding action-related data 122 1,..., 122 n to the transmitted current coordinates of the mobile device 11, ie whether at the location specified by the coordinates, in which the mobile device 11 is currently operating, an action 15 is to be triggered.
  • the determining module 121 finds in the data 122 1,..., 122_n stored in the memory module 122 a corresponding link between the transmitted or transmitted coordinates of the mobile device 11 and an action 15, S4 transmits the discovering module 121 or the information server 12 the action-related data to the mobile device 11.
  • the evaluation of coordinates of the mobile device 11 with respect to the locally triggered electronically controlled can be done in various ways. According to the present embodiment, the determining module 121 performs matching between the stored coordinates 122_1,..., 122_n and the current coordinates of the mobile device 11.
  • the action-related data sent to the mobile device 11 has identification information for identifying and locating a web service 13 in the system 1.
  • this identification information is a URL (Uniform Resource Locator).
  • the web service 13 is a service that enables and / or controls triggering of the respective action 15 at the coordinates of the mobile device and with respect to the mobile device.
  • the mobile device 11 receives the URL of the web service 13 and automatically makes a request to initiate or execute the respective action 15 to the web service 13.
  • the request is an HTTP GET request, such as in particular in the context of communicating data over a network knows.
  • the request or the HTTP GET request may have context information of the mobile device 11.
  • the request or the HTTP GET request with context information of the mobile device 11 can be parameterizable, for example having user authentication information or parameters. In this context, many different context information or parameters are possible. They are in particular conditioned by the respective application or action 15.
  • S5 transmits the mobile device 11 the HTTP GET request to the web service 13.
  • the web service 13 then controls the triggering and / or execution of the respective action 15. Since the respective action 15 is an electronically controlled action, which is triggered and / or executed by executing a code specifying the action 15, the web service 13 is in accordance with The present embodiment is configured to control the execution of the code specifying the action 15. For this, the weaving service 13 may have its own mechanisms designed for this purpose, which need not be known to the outside world.
  • the web service 13 is configured to determine a control device or a control system 14 in the system 1 that can perform the actual triggering or driving of the respective action 15. After the respective control device or the respective control system 14 has been determined, the web service 13 prepares a corresponding activation request for the activation of the respective action 15.
  • the activation request may contain suitable parameters for activating and / or executing the respective action 15 and / or information the mobile device 11 have.
  • S6 transmits the web service 13 the control request to the control device or to the control system 14.
  • the controller or control system 14 will then initiate the triggering and / or execution of the respective S8 actions associated with the coordinates of the mobile device.
  • the web service 13 may also be configured to perform the actual triggering and / or execution of the action 15 itself.
  • control device or the control system 14 may notify the web service 13 of initiating and / or executing the action 15.
  • the web service 13 will then in turn notify the mobile device 11 of the initiation and / or execution of the action 15 S9.
  • These notifications made in steps S7 and / or S9 can then be correspondingly prepared and / or displayed on the user interface 16.
  • location-based execution via HTTP GET requests to third-party web services can be realized without expensive construction.
  • the present invention provides a way to associate an executable code of an action with location coordinates. So any electronically controllable action can be triggered by the mere approach to a place. In this case, the action is executed only if the mobile device or its user is located at a location specified by the location coordinates of the respective action

Abstract

La présente invention concerne un déclenchement localisé d'une action (15) déclenchable localement et commandée électroniquement. Un dispositif de gestion d'informations (12) est configuré pour évaluer les coordonnées d'un dispositif mobile (11) par rapport à l'action (15), et pour transmettre (S5) au dispositif mobile (11), si les coordonnées du dispositif mobile (11) correspondent aux coordonnées à partir desquelles l'action (15) doit être déclenchée, une information d'identification par laquelle est identifié et localisé un service Internet (13) assurant la commande du déclenchement de l'action (15). Le dispositif mobile (11) est configuré pour recevoir l'information d'identification, pour établir une demande de déclenchement localisé de l'action en utilisant l'information d'identification, et pour transmettre (85) la demande au service Internet (13). L'établissement et la transmission de la demande sont effectués sans tenir compte des données saisies dans le dispositif mobile (11), automatiquement après réception de l'information d'identification. Le service Internet (13) commande le déclenchement de l'action (15). On obtient ainsi une amélioration du déclenchement localisé d'une action (15). L'invention s'applique en particulier dans les cas où un déclenchement localisé d'actions et souhaité.
